Understanding the German Drogerie
To really appreciate the German drugstore, one must first comprehend the distinction in between a Drogerie and an Apotheke (pharmacy).
- The Apotheke (Pharmacy): This is where prescription medications, strong over the counter drugs, and specialized medical advice are dispensed. They are strictly controlled and typically staffed by pharmacists in white coats.
- The Drogerie (Drugstore): This is where one opts for health, Abnehmtabletten Kaufen Deutschland appeal, individual care, baby products, cleaning materials, and healthy foods. Prescription drugs are not offered here.

Founded in 1973, dm is a cultural example in Germany. Germans regularly vote dm as their favorite seller. The stores are diligently organized, wheelchair- and stroller-friendly, and lit with warm, inviting lighting. dm is particularly famous for pioneering the "personal label" transformation in Germany, using premium-quality cosmetics and skin care at a fraction of the cost of name brands.
2. Dirk Rossmann GmbH (Rossmann)
As the second-largest chain, Rossmann is common throughout German towns and cities. Rossmann is understood for aggressive discounting, weekly discount coupon books, and a fantastic digital app. While its store design can sometimes feel a little more practical than dm, its product range is equally impressive.
3. Müller
Müller stands apart because it works almost like a mini-department store. While it has the same comprehensive drugstore and natural food areas as dm and Rossmann, a typical Müller will likewise include an enormous toy department, a stationery and book area, and a high-end luxury perfume counter.

The Magic of German Drugstore House Brands (Eigenmarken)
One of the biggest tricks of the German drugstore is the quality of its private-label brand names. In many countries, store-brand products are deemed low-cost, inferior options to name brands. In Germany, the reverse is typically real.
German customer publications (like Stiftung Warentest) regularly test pharmacy house brands versus high-end brands, and Eigenmarken regularly win top honors for quality, component security, and worth.
Popular House Brands to Look For:
- Balea (dm): The undisputed king of budget plan body care. From shower gels that change aromas seasonally to abundant body milks and facial serums, Balea is a cult favorite.
- Alverde (dm): A certified natural cosmetics (Naturkosmetik) brand that is exceptionally cost effective.
- Isana (Rossmann): Similar to Balea, providing a huge range of hair, skin, and bath items with terrific performance reviews.
- Babylove (dm) & & Babydream (Rossmann): Lifesavers for parents, using high-performing diapers and infant care items without the premium price tag.
Tips for Shopping Like a Local
If you desire to mix in perfectly during your next journey down the drugstore aisles in Germany, keep these useful ideas in mind:
- Bring Your Own Bags: Like a lot of German retailers, pharmacies do not distribute complimentary plastic bags. Constantly bring a recyclable tote bag (Jutebeutel).
- Download the Apps: If you live in Germany or visit frequently, download the dm or Rossmann apps. They use digital vouchers, loyalty points, and scratch-and-win discount rates that can conserve you a substantial quantity of money.
- Shop the Sale Bins: Near the front or center of the shops, you will typically find clearance bins featuring seasonal products, stopped aromas, or overstocked products greatly discounted.
- Inspect the Certifications: German consumers care deeply about sustainability. Search for relied on German seals on items, such as:
- Natrue: Certified natural cosmetics.
- Vegan Flower: Certified 100% vegan products.
- Blauer Engel: Germany's official eco-label for eco-friendly items.
- Coin for the Shopping Cart: If you require a shopping cart, you will need a 1-euro or 50-cent coin to unlock it (which you return when you return it).
